Cavalier King Charles Spaniel: Price, Breed Information, and Temperament in India

Bringing a Cavalier King Charles Spaniel into your home is a delightful experience, but it’s essential to be well-informed about their cost and characteristics. In India, the price for a Cavalier King Charles Spaniel puppy typically ranges from Rs 20,000 to Rs 50,000. Before adopting your new companion, it’s crucial to find reputable and certified breeders, especially in areas like Delhi/NCR and Noida. These breeders are dedicated to the well-being of the breed and ensure their puppies are healthy and happy. Preparing your home for your new furry family member and finding a suitable veterinarian are also vital steps. King Charles Spaniel Breed Information

History

The Cavalier King Charles Spaniel, named after King Charles II, has a rich history. Descended from the original King Charles Spaniels, this breed saw further development in the late 1600s when they were crossbred with Pugs. This crossbreeding resulted in a smaller dog with distinctive features like an upturned face, a flatter nose, prominent eyes, and a rounded head. In the 1940s, the prefix “Cavalier” was added to differentiate them from other King Charles Spaniels, and they were eventually recognized as a distinct breed. The American Kennel Club (AKC) officially recognized the Cavalier King Charles Spaniel as its 140th breed on January 1, 1996.

Appearance

The Cavalier King Charles Spaniel is an elegant toy spaniel with a moderate build, retaining the essence of a working spaniel in a smaller package. These dogs are well-proportioned and possess a slightly rounded head with a full muzzle that tapers slightly, complemented by a shallow stop. They have dark brown, round eyes with dark rims, set apart to give them an expressive look. Their long ears are set high and adorned with abundant feathering. While their tail is often left natural, it may sometimes be docked by one-third. The Cavalier’s coat is silky and of medium length, with significant feathering on the ears, legs, tail, and chest. The breed comes in several colors: tan and black, ruby (a rich mahogany red), Blenheim (white and red), and tri-color.

Temperament

Cavalier King Charles Spaniels, like many breeds, exhibit a range of personalities, from calm and quiet to energetic and playful. They are known for being affectionate, happy, and eager to please, often expressing their joy through tail wags. However, they are not ideally suited as guard dogs or watchdogs, as their barking tendencies can vary, and they may not alert you to strangers or intruders reliably. While some may bark at strangers, they are generally not ferocious protectors. For those seeking a watchful guardian and protector for your house, other breeds might be a better fit. Cavaliers are easily trained and friendly, making them excellent companions for families with young children and other pets. Their adaptable nature and affectionate disposition make them a wonderful addition to many households. The breed’s gentle nature also means they are well-suited for households where they can receive ample attention and companionship. Their desire to be close to their owners makes them prone to separation anxiety if left alone for extended periods. Consistent training and socialization from a young age are key to ensuring a well-adjusted Cavalier.
